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ions Cisco Adaptive Security Appliance (ASA) Software (affected versions not specified) Cisco Firepower Threat Defense (FTD) Software (affected versions not specified)
Description A vulnerability in the AnyConnect SSL VPN feature could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to cause a denial of service (DoS) condition on an affected device. This issue is due to an implementation error within the SSL/TLS session handling process that can prevent the release of a session handler under specific conditions. An attacker could exploit this by sending crafted SSL/TLS traffic to an affected device, increasing the probability of session handler leaks.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to eventually deplete the available session handler pool, preventing new sessions from being established and causing a DoS condition.
Recommendations At the moment, there is no information about a newer version that contains a fix for this vulnerability.
